Hello. I just received my new whip from Joe Strain today. I wanted something like what he provided to the production and not just a version of the Jacka whip. After talking to Joe, he made me a whip that would be what his looked like if they darkened the knots and all on the ones he sent. He said it was the only CS whip he'd ever made with the traditional 3 pass knots.
